Mercury and water are poured in communicating vessels. height of the water column 34. How much lower is the level of mercury.

To calculate the location of the mercury level relative to the water level, we use the formula: Δh = hв – hрт = hв – (ρв * g * hв) / (ρрт * g) = hв * (1 – ρв / ρрт).
Data: hв – water column (hв = 34 cm); ρw – water density (ρw = 10 ^ 3 kg / m3); ρрт – density of mercury (ρрт = 13.6 * 10 ^ 3 kg / m3).
Calculation: Δh = hв * (1 – ρв / ρрт) = 34 * (1 – 10 ^ 3 / (13.6 * 10 ^ 3)) = 31.5 cm.
Answer: The mercury level is 31.5 cm lower.
